By means of two video games, the New York Giants are 0-2, scoring simply a median of 12 factors per sport. Their offense is definitely a difficulty however their protection is regarding as nicely.
The Giants are getting chewed up by the run, permitting 163 yards per sport to opponents over the primary two weeks. They’ve been lax on third downs, allowing opponents to transform on 41.7 p.c of makes an attempt, and have did not cease both of their two fourth-down probabilities.
Consequently, opponents have been capable of maintain drives and hold onto the soccer. Final week in Washington, the Giants misplaced the time of possession 37:32 to 22:28.
